Manufacturer | Rockwell Automation |
---|---|
Brand | Allen-Bradley |
Part Number/Catalog No. | 140G-H2C4-C60 |
Product Type | Molded Case Circuit Breaker |
Frame | H |
Amps | 125 |
Interrupting Rating | 25 kA |
Protection Type | Fixed Thermal/ Fixed Magnetic |
Poles | 4 |
Current Range | 60 A |
Rated Insulation Voltage | 1000 V |
Rated Impulse Withstand Voltage | 8 kV |
Weight | 3.53 lb |
Mechanical Life | 240 Operations/hr. |
Electrical Life | 120 Operations/hr. |
The Allen-Bradley 140G-H2C4-C60 is a fine example of a molded case circuit breaker specifically tailored for demanding electrical environments. It operates within the H frame size, accommodating currents up to 125 Amps. As a critical safety device, it features both fixed thermal and fixed magnetic protection, ensuring effective interruption during faults.
The circuit breaker boasts a notable interrupting rating of 25 kA, allowing it to clear high fault currents efficiently. It utilizes a four-pole configuration for versatility in various setups. Designed to handle a current range of 60 A, it guarantees reliable performance across a wide array of applications. The rated insulation voltage is set at 1000 V, giving it the ability to withstand high electrical stress under normal operating conditions. For transient voltages, it is rated at 8 kV, providing further assurance of its operational integrity.
Weighing 3.53 lb, the 140G-H2C4-C60 is manageable for installation and integration into existing systems. Its impressive mechanical life, rated at 240 operations per hour, allows it to endure prolonged periods of use effectively. The electrical life rating stands at 120 operations per hour, indicating its capability to support frequent electrical cycling with minimal wear.
